AF Assist

You can enable or disable the AF-assist illuminator, which assists autofocus operation when
the subject is dimly lit.

d button M z tab M AF assist M k button

Option

Description

Auto
(default setting)

The AF-assist illuminator lights automatically when the subject is dimly lit.
The illuminator has a range of about 4.5 m (14 ft) at the maximum wide-angle
position and about 3.0 m (9 ft 10 in.) at the maximum telephoto position.
Note that for some scene modes such as Museum (

A 38) and Pet portrait

(

A 40), the AF-assist illuminator may not light even when Auto is selected.

Off

The AF-assist illuminator does not light. The camera may be unable to focus
under dim lighting.
